Author: markt
Date: Thu Mar 7 15:13:38 2013
New Revision: 1453911
URL: http://svn.apache.org/r1453911
Log:
Fix infinite loop
Modified:
tomcat/trunk/java/org/apache/tomcat/websocket/server/DefaultServerEndpointConfigurator.java
Modified:
tomcat/trunk/java/org/apache/tomcat/websocket/server/DefaultServerEndpointConfigurator.java
URL:
http://svn.apache.org/viewvc/tomcat/trunk/java/org/apache/tomcat/websocket/server/DefaultServerEndpointConfigurator.java?rev=1453911&r1=1453910&r2=1453911&view=diff
==============================================================================
---
tomcat/trunk/java/org/apache/tomcat/websocket/server/DefaultServerEndpointConfigurator.java
(original)
+++
tomcat/trunk/java/org/apache/tomcat/websocket/server/DefaultServerEndpointConfigurator.java
Thu Mar 7 15:13:38 2013
@@ -30,6 +30,19 @@ public class DefaultServerEndpointConfig
extends ServerEndpointConfig.Configurator {
@Override
+ public <T> T getEndpointInstance(Class<T> clazz)
+ throws InstantiationException {
+ try {
+ return clazz.newInstance();
+ } catch (IllegalAccessException e) {
+ InstantiationException ie = new InstantiationException();
+ ie.initCause(e);
+ throw ie;
+ }
+ }
+
+
+ @Override
public String getNegotiatedSubprotocol(List<String> supported,
List<String> requested) {
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]